Astros starter Wandy Rodriguez is one of the more unsung starting pitchers in all of baseball. He pitches for a struggling Astros team, but has the 26th highest WAR, 20th lowest ERA, and 26th highest K/BB rate since 2009 amongst all starting pitchers, but you never hear him mentioned as one of the top 20 starting pitchers in baseball. But, he is letting his pitching do the talking for him.
On Tuesday, Wandy-Rod pitched a gem, but had nothing to show for it, as closer Mark Melancon gave up a game tying HR to Brian McCann with two out in the 9th inning. He gave up just 5 hits, 2 walks and 6 strikeouts in 8 shutout innings on Tuesday and is now 2-3 with a 3.45 ERA, a 1.32 WHIP, and 47-13 K/BB rate. He has 4 starts this year where he has given up one run or less with one win and 3 no-decisions to show for it.
